Output 58cf2999c6fc33a2793b4dc3d13629b9e0fcf8dfd48ec311728b078f11d8ed4e:1

value
20419238
script pubkey
OP_0 OP_PUSHBYTES_20 1469a4970adc69432f9737d46b4162ec28fbb956
address
bc1qz356f9c2m355xtuhxl2xkstzas50hw2ksgufhv
transaction
58cf2999c6fc33a2793b4dc3d13629b9e0fcf8dfd48ec311728b078f11d8ed4e
spent
true